- Description
Talks to the dancer and choreographer about her creation of the Rugby World Cup opening ceremony dance, and the creation of the New Zealand Dance Company in 2012, of which she will be executive and artistic director. Outlines the company's impetus and organisation, the funding it received from Creative New Zealand's Toi Uru Kahikatea arts development investment programme, and the inaugural 2012 tour 'Language of living'.
